I am using SAS Studio via WRDS. I love using SAS Studio but there seems to be one major limitation, I am unable to upload files that are larger than 10MB. SInce I am using WRDS I am not able to create a shared folder as recommended (https://communities.sas.com/t5/SAS-Analytics-U/Upload-more-than-10-MB-to-SAS-on-AWS/m-p/248212#M2996).
Any help would be appreciated.

One of my fellow students helped me out. Use winscp and link to WRDS server. Just google "SSH and SP500" to receive setup directions.
Works like a charm. Also easy access to save all your files on hard disk.

WRDS is a specific installation managed by Wharton. You would have to discuss the limitations and set up with them. They can install SAS Studio without that restriction, AFAIK.
